Reports included scores of youths rampaging through a shopping area asfurther looting and rioting spread across England. The violence began in London before the weekend but has continued into the early part of this week. An extra 1,700 police officers were deployed in London, where shops were looted and buildings were set alight. Locations like Birmingham, Liverpool, Nottingham and Bristol also saw violence. More than 69 people have been charged with various offences. A senior union leader has warned the Government that talks aimed at averting strikes were now in "jeopardy". The criticism from Dave Prentis, general secretary of Unison, followed an expected announcement from ministers that public sector workers will have to pay up to £3,000 a year more to keep up their pension schemes. Mr Prentis added: "These talks are being put in jeopardy by the crude and naïve tactics of Government ministers who don't seem to understand the word negotiate." A football club will this weekend do the supporting for a change as it pledges allegiance to an ailing local train firm. Players of Derby County FC will go on the pitch against Birmingham City wearing T-shirts during the warm-up and workers at the firm Bombardier will carry a large banner on to the pitch. Children of Bombardier workers will be mascots at the match. Bombardier recently received a blow when the government said a rival bid offered tax-payers better value. A 200 metre cordon had to be put around a fire on open ground because there was danger that an acetylene cylinder would explode. The incident was first reported on Wednesday (August 3) at Rhondda Cynon Taf in South-East Wales. Officers from South Wales Police said the area will stay closed until the fire service gives the all-clear. Fire officials revealed they left the blaze to cool overnight and were going back this morning to assess the situation. Cable theft has this week caused transport delays in many parts of south-east England. Rail services in Essex and Cambridgeshire were severely hit after overhead power cables were stolen. Network Rail said the theft affected other overhead lines, some of which came down in Essex late on Wednesday (September 21). The Stansted Express and Broxbourne to Cambridge services have been suspended, National Express East Anglia said. The company added it did not expect trains to run until 13:00 BST. A large amount of diesel stolen from two vehicles has been the latest in a series of recent fuel theft incidents. Thieves siphoned the substantial quantities of diesel from two trucks in east Surrey. Police believe the theft of fuel from a building site in Walton-on-Thames could be linked to this incident. Officers explained that as fuel becomes more expensive it becomes more attractive to thieves and urged all vehicle owners to take extra precautions. A series of suspected arson attacks has probably permanently closed a community BMX bike track. The track in Wrexham cost £18,000 to complete, funded through grants and the local community council. Because the equipment was not insured the community council cannot afford to replace the burned wreckage. The track cost £11,000, mostly raised via grants, and the council added £7,000 for a site and soil survey, since it was on the site of a former tip. This week has been a case of ‘mind the pay gap’ after it was revealed Tube drivers will get £50,000 per year. London Underground (LU) says a new four-year wage deal negotiated with union leaders meant the pay of train drivers, currently around £46,000, will go over the £50,000 mark. Under the deal, LU staff will get a 5 per cent pay increase this year followed by RPI inflation plus 0.5% in the ensuing three years. Eight people were hurt after an explosion and fire caused devastation at an industrial estate in Surrey. Of the eight who received injuries, two are thought to have sustained serious burns. One of them was airlifted to a London hospital, while the others were taken to nearby hospitals. One witness Natalie Dugdale told Sky News she heard three explosions and could see "masses and masses of smoke". She said fire officers told her the blast was caused by recycled printer toner. The UK government is expected to respond fully within the next month to a report which says the railway industry could make annual savings of £1bn. The independent report pushes forward the use of machines to replace ticket offices currently provided and staffed by rail company employees. Rail consumer watchdog Passenger Focus said ticket machines were "second rate" compared to a staffed ticket office. The Department of Transport said it is reviewing staffing options. Officers from the Warwickshire and Leicestershire police forces mounted a joint operation and used automatic number plate recognition technology to catch a gang of criminals. As a result the men were arrested in a ‘sting’ to clamp down upon metal thefts and burglary along the A5 road, which runs through both counties. A variety of goods which were believed to have been stolen were recovered. A proposal to keep 24-hour cover for Windsor fire station will go to public consultation on Monday (October 3) for three months and if approved the round the clock service will start in April 2012. This ends a five-year battle to save the town's station from night-time closure. The Fire Authority agreed a proposal for the cover using a smaller fire engine and fewer crew at a council meeting on Wednesday.
